Hey, I'm Wulfric, your deputy Speaker, and I'm running for another term as Southern Delegate!

My Atlas History:

In my current term of appointment to the Southern Chamber, I serve in the role of deputy speaker. I have been a great asset to the chamber as we have worked through a larger than usual queue of bills, and because of my leadership and the work of others in the chamber, we will leave little to no 'holdover' for the next session to deal with.

In my first term of appointment to the Southern Chamber, I sponsored the Arizona Solution bill, ensuring that no major party can use midterm appointments to extend their majority in the chamber. I also worked to appropriately narrow the scope of the Raccoon Resistance Act.

I was previously elected to a term in the Lincoln Assembly. When serving in the Lincoln Assembly, I sponsored a bill, and supported a second bill, to streamline the hearing process for the Lincoln Cabinet, allowing non-controversial nominees to proceed quickly while preserving a fair filibuster procedure for controversial nominees. I also fought to ensure that Judge Blair and Governor ReaganClinton would not trick the legislature into passing legislation that may have absolutely prohibited the legislature from ever regulating abortion in any manner.

Pre-reset, I served in the Pacific Assembly and as Pacific Judicial Officer.


My general platform at this point in time is Center-Right Socially and a Moderate Liberal on other issues. I believe my answers to the forum provide a more precise platform: https://uselectionatlas.org/FORUM/index.php?topic=311126.msg6627475#msg6627475

I welcome your questions, and please give me your vote.
